Teflon coatings, scientifically known as , are among the most versatile synthetic materials in modern industry. Initially a "lucky accident" discovered in 1938, PTFE has evolved from a secret component of the Manhattan Project into a ubiquitous material used in everything from non-stick cookware to aerospace insulation.
